Nurturing Interests Alongside Studies is Essential: Badekkila Pradeep

Extracurricular activities serve as a foundation for life skills training, balancing academics while fostering personal growth. Alongside education, nurturing one’s interests is essential, stated renowned voice artist, anchor, and actor Badekkila Pradeep.

He was addressing the valedictory ceremony of ‘Kalarava,’ an inter-college and inter-class festival organized by the Department of Humanities at Sri Dharmasthala Manjunatheshwara (SDM) College, Ujire, on February 24, where he was the chief guest.

“Extracurricular activities build strong personalities and keep individuals lively. Pursuing hobbies and interests alongside academics enables holistic development. Do not abandon your passions; let them be the fuel for your happiness,” he advised. Guest speaker and young entrepreneur Rajesh M.K. emphasized the importance of remembering one’s educational institutions and mentors. He encouraged students to develop life skills alongside formal education and contribute positively to society.

Dr. Vishwanath P., Dean of SDM Postgraduate Centre, presided over the event and stressed the significance of experiential learning beyond the classroom. “Success cannot be achieved through textbooks alone. Creativity, efficiency, and an openness to new ideas pave the way for innovation. Events like these play a crucial role in fostering such skills,” he remarked. The event featured eleven competitions. In the inter-college contests, Puttur’s Vivekananda College secured first place, while Roshni Nilaya College, Mangaluru, claimed second place. In the inter-class category, third-year BCA students won the overall championship. Prizes were distributed to the winners.
